LEBANON, KY (April 27, 2026) – Kentucky State Police (KSP) Post 15 Troopers were requested by the Marion County Sheriff’s Office to respond to a two-vehicle injury collision just before 5 A.M. EDT on Sunday morning, on US 68 (Danville Highway) in Marion County.

 

The preliminary investigation revealed that Mahalia Brown, 43, of Magnolia, Mississippi, was traveling west on US 68 in a 2018 Toyota Camry.  Ms. Brown crossed the centerline and entered the eastbound lane of US 68 into the path of a 2018 Kenworth dump truck traveling east on US 68, operated by Christopher Perkins, 49, of Campbellsville.  Mr. Perkins attempted to avoid a collision by braking and steering, but was unable to do so, and the two vehicles collided in a head-on manner. 

 

Mahalia Brown, along with a passenger in her vehicle, Benjamin Thompson, 20, of Magnolia, Mississippi, were pronounced deceased at the scene by the Marion County Coroner.  A second passenger in Ms. Brown’s vehicle, Darian Thompson, 22, of Magnolia, Mississippi, was transported to Spring View Hospital for treatment of serious injuries.  Christopher Perkins was also transported ot Spring View Hospital for treatment of minor injuries.

 

KSP Post 15 Troopers were assisted at the scene by the Marion County Sheriff's Office, Marion County EMS, Lebanon Fire Department, Gravel Switch Fire Department and the Marion County Coroner’s Office.  Detective Weston Sullivan is investigating the collision.
